
Moments: Mother
10.0/10
Release: 02/11/2022
Duration: 0h 6m

A woman looking for her kidnapped son finds one of the men who took him.
Country: United States of America
Language: English
Director:Michael Vaughn Hernandez
Writers
| Writer:Darren Bailey
Production
Creative Duet Media
Official Website:
http://directorvaughn.com/portfo...
